TRP channels are cation channels involved with pain perception and thermosensation [47]. TRPV1 is activated by quite a few stimuli, such as heat (>forty two °C), vanilloids, lipids, and protons/cations. Quite a few very selective TRPV1 antagonists are currently in clinical development to the therapy of pain. Although the use of desensitizing TRPV1 agonists minimizes pain sensitivity [forty eight,49], recent scientific trials have proven that blocking TRPV1 also has an effect on system temperature. This unfortunate side influence has halted A great deal on the drug progress exercise targeting this channel. Topical application, on the other hand, continues to be demonstrated for being productive in stopping the Original pain flare-up that happens with agonist-induced nociceptor excitation before desensitization. TRPM8 is activated in vitro by chilly temperatures (ten–23 °C) and cooling brokers such as icilin and menthol. Researchers have not too long ago discovered that the TRPM8 antagonist 15 produces an analgesic result in experimental models of cold pain in people without impacting Main human body temperature [50].

The transmission of pain is connected to nociceptors, which are a specialised subset of sensory neurons that mediate pain and densely innervate peripheral tissues. Numerous subsets of nociceptors are even further divided in accordance with the variety of stimuli (mechanical, chemical, thermal, or noxious) they reply to [one]. Nociceptors are predominantly produced up of nerve terminals that Categorical each ligand and voltage-gated ion channels [two]. Nociceptor neuron action and pain sensitivity is usually modulated by immune cells that release mediators. Immune cells, subsequently, might be modulated because of the nociceptors that launch neuropeptides and neurotransmitters that act on innate and adaptive immune cells. In this manner, the immune reaction is affected by neural signaling, and As a result, this neural signaling contributes to the development of community and systemic inflammatory disorders.

Nociception utilised interchangeably with nociperception would be the response of our bodies’ sensory anxious programs in direction of actual or likely unsafe stimuli. The sensory endings that happen to be activated by these kinds of stimuli are called nociceptors, that happen to be predominantly accountable for the primary phase of pain sensations. Fundamentally, the Aδ- and C-fibers are two varieties of Most important afferent nociceptors responding to noxious stimuli presented within our bodies’ [7].

There are three big roles for that receptors in the principal afferent neurons, which are excitatory, sensitizing and inhibitory response. After these receptors are being stimulated and also have arrived at the pain threshold, the ensuing impulses are propagated along the afferent fibers toward the DH (PNS) and medulla (cranial). In addition to that, There's a further nociceptor known as silent nociceptors. Silent nociceptors are located within the viscera and these afferent nerve fibers don't have any terminal morphological specializations without responses to noxious stimuli, but can only be sensitized from the chemical mediators developed during inflammatory reactions.

There are actually frequently 3 main levels in the notion of pain. The initial phase is pain sensitivity, followed by the 2nd phase in which the indicators are transmitted within the periphery on the dorsal horn (DH), which is found within the spinal cord by way of the peripheral anxious system (PNS). And lastly, the third phase should be to accomplish the transmission of your alerts to the upper Mind by using the central anxious technique (CNS). Commonly, There's two routes for sign transmissions to generally be executed: ascending and descending pathways. The pathway that goes upward carrying sensory information from your body by way of the spinal wire in direction of the Mind is outlined because the ascending pathway, Whilst the nerves that goes downward from the Mind towards the reflex organs by using the spinal wire is referred to as the descending pathway.

Yet another home of nociceptor neurons is their efferent function. It can be crucial to note that just some nociceptors, such as, peptidergic nociceptors, have this purpose and therefore are capable of releasing substances from their peripheral terminals. This characteristic serves to guarantee the upkeep of tissue integrity while in the absence of tissue hurt. For illustration, nociceptive nerves are demanded for enforced hematopoietic stem mobile (HSC) mobilization, and so they collaborate with sympathetic nerves to maintain HSCs in bone [26]. Neurogenic inflammation may very well be created from a rise in the peripheral release of afferent transmitters during sterile inflammation for instance that connected with migraines [27]. Hence the release of molecules from nociceptors will not be solely connected with the entire process of inflammation but collaborates so that you can bring on the pain associated with tissue problems [28].
